DECISION & ORDER ON MOTION

Motion by the appellants to extend the time to perfect an appeal from an order of the Supreme Court, Kings County, dated January 2, 2019.

Upon the papers filed in support of the motion and no papers having been filed in opposition or in relation thereto, it is

ORDERED that the motion is granted, the appellants' time to perfect the appeal is extended until January 15, 2020, and the record or appendix on the appeal and the appellants' brief shall be served and filed on or before that date; and it is further,

ORDERED that no further extension of time shall be granted.

SCHEINKMAN, P.J., HINDS-RADIX, BARROS and WOOTEN, JJ., concur.
